Added Role list in user_stories.apt
[staff/due1/sed-hs15-srs-purple.git] / src / site / apt / user_stories.apt
CommitLineData
73eb5808
ED
1 ----------
2 User Stories
3 ----------
4 due1
5 ----------
6 October 03, 2015
7
8User Stories
9
10 This document describes the (initial) set of user stories as well as the
11roles users have when using the Smart Reservation System (SRS).
12
13* 1. Roles
14
15 Describe the roles you have identified. I recommend to use a definition
16list:
17
0b13a5d0
M
18 [User] Student or Customer who wants to makes reservations and have an overview over his reservations.
19 [Resource Manager] Employee who is responsible to manage resources.
20 [Administrator] Employee who is responsible to manage users.
73eb5808
ED
21
22* 2. User Stories
23
24 Describe the user stories you have identified so far. Provide a table,
25and number the stories. Provide a short text for each user story by using
26the format as presented in the script. In the last column, provide one
27or more criteria which can be used to validate whether the user story is
28correctly implemented.
29
30
31
32*-----------+---------------------------------------+---------------------------+
33| <<No>> | <<Description>> | <<Validation>> |
34*-----------+---------------------------------------+---------------------------+
4b9fbda0
M
35| 01 | - Als User, will ich einen einfachen | damit ich schnell und |
36| | Zugang zum Reservationssystem, | einfach Reservationen |
37| | | machen kann. |
73eb5808 38*-----------+---------------------------------------+---------------------------+
4b9fbda0
M
39| 02 | - Als User, will ich über verschiedene| sodass ich von überall her|
40| | Geräte wie Smartphone, Laptop, | Reservationen machen kann.|
41| | Desktop Computer Zugang zum System | |
42| | haben, | |
73eb5808 43*-----------+---------------------------------------+---------------------------+
4b9fbda0
M
44| 03 | - Als User, will ich eine Ressource | damit diese Ressource von |
45| | Reservieren können, | keinem anderen User |
46| | | benutzt werden kann um |
7d00699b 47| | | diese Zeit. |
73eb5808 48*-----------+---------------------------------------+---------------------------+
4b9fbda0
M
49| 04 | - Als User, will ich sehen welche | damit ich mir schnell |
50| | Ressourcen frei und welche besetzt | einen Überblick schaffen |
51| | sind | kann. |
52*-----------+---------------------------------------+---------------------------+
53| 05 | - Als User, will ich wiederkehrende | damit ich nicht für jede |
54| | Reservierungen nur einmal machen | Woche wieder dieselben |
55| | müssen, | Ressourcen reservieren |
56| | | muss. |
57*-----------+---------------------------------------+---------------------------+
58| 06 | - Als resource managers, will ich auf | damit ich darüber ganz |
59| | meinen Computern ein client haben, | einfach neue Ressourcen |
60| | | zum Reservationssystem |
61| | | hinzufügen kann. |
62*-----------+---------------------------------------+---------------------------+
63| 07 | - Als resource managers, will ich | damit ich weiss wer die |
64| | sehen wer welche Ressourcen zu | Ressourcen gebraucht. |
65| | welcher Zeit gebucht hat | |
66*-----------+---------------------------------------+---------------------------+
67| 08 | - Als Administrator, will ich die User| damit es keine Login |
68| | sowie auch resource managers | Konflikte gibt. |
69| | verwalten können | |
70*-----------+---------------------------------------+---------------------------+
71
73eb5808
ED
72
73
74* 3. Open Issues
75
76 Add here any open issues, if any.